The incandescent lamp is the traditional lighting solution. This device, installed in a floodlight sealed to the pool wall, equips the largest number of pools. Its power varies from 100 to 300 Watts. Its consumption is relatively high. The average life of an incandescent lamp is about 3000 hours.

The halogen pool projector

The halogen lamp is an interesting alternative. A halogen lamp floodlight is also sealed at the pool wall. This type of device has the advantage of consuming less, between 50 to 100 Watts only, for equivalent lighting quality. This type of lighting, however, has the disadvantage of being more directional than the incandescent lamp, namely 30 ° against 90 ° for a traditional lamp.

The LED lamp is needed today as the “must” of lighting. It has the advantage https://poolclinics.com/reviews/best-above-ground-pool-lights/ of consuming little (25, 48 or 60 Watts for the most powerful) and their lifespan is estimated at 30000 or 50000 hours. The LED allows active lighting, ie a multicolored and programmable lighting. The marriage of the 3 primary colors (red, green, blue) allows various multicolored and animated atmospheres. It is also possible to obtain only very intense white lighting.

The optical fiber projector

The optical fiber, remains a high-end solution to illuminate its basin. This solution is to travel around the basin, optical fibers. Fiber optic lighting is the ability to drive the desired amount of light to the exact spot where it is needed. The optical fiber brings a new freedom in the design of the lighting. The light is generated by a source device (the optical fiber generator). The user has a range of possibilities: color change, diffusion of a fixed color, continuous or alternating light … The possibilities are numerous …

The arrangement of the headlamp

The layout of the lighting depends on the characteristics of the pool (the shape and dimensions) and the configuration of the surrounding areas. A 300 watt incandescent lamp can be used to illuminate a 10 x 5 meter pool. We will opt for 2 projectors of 100 Watts in halogen version. When choosing the device, it is important to target uniform lighting to illuminate the entire pool. It is also recommended not to position the pool spotlights facing the house, to avoid being dazzled and to take full advantage of the radiation by reflection. For maintenance, Care should be taken to install the niches at a maximum depth of 50 cm. It will be possible to change the lamp without entering the water. It is also necessary to clean this niche where the algae will tend to settle.

Other lighting devices

There are currently other ways to develop a colorful atmosphere: floating lamps, existing in different shapes and sizes, the markup integrated to the pool area around the pool, lighting spots integrated comfort equipment or decoration such as water cascades, light pots, light reeds, … Whatever the type of pool lighting, it will be necessary to comply with the standards for electrical installations.
